How do you open the last door in Drangleic Castle?
As you arrive at the castle door, you will see two Royal Swordsman, after killing these, they will continue to spawn around the left side of the castle. You must kill them close enough to the stone guardians either side of the door, they will absorb the souls and open the door for you.Is Drangleic Castle the last area?

The Throne Room is part of Drangleic Castle and the final section of Dark Souls 2. Here, the player faces the Throne Defender & Watcher, then moves on for the ultimate battle against Nashandra.Who is the final boss of DS2?
The final boss of Dark Souls 2, Nashandra is the evil queen of Drangleic. She wields a scythe, employs magic, and applies curse effects constantly throughout the fight.How do you unlock the cage in Drangleic Castle?
After defeating the Demon of Song, the Key to the Embedded is given. Return to the second bonfire at Drangleic Castle leading to the King's Passage. Take the white elevator all the way to the top. Use the key on the body wrapped around the cage.How do you get under Castle Drangleic?
Under Castle Drangleic: From the King's Gate bonfire, in the large room, go to the far back left door and open it by slaying a Stone Soldier near it. Drop down the hole inside and this bonfire should be in plain view.How to trigger the final boss in DS2?

The Throne of Want is the final location in Dark Souls II, where the Bearer of the Curse must best the Throne Watcher and Defender and Nashandra to become a true monarch and claim the Throne. However, if the player has killed Vendrick before Nashandra, Aldia will appear as the final boss.Is Drangleic built on Lordran?
In Dark Souls 2 we learned that Drangleic was basically Lordran after several centuries and the rise and fall of several kingdoms. How many endings does ds2 have?
In Dark Souls II, there are two endings from which the player may chose: Proceed to Throne or Leave Throne. The Proceed to Throne ending was the default ending until Scholar of The First Sin version was released, and was the default in the original Dark Souls II before the "Scholar of the First Sin" update.How to unlock krypt throne room?
